Due to expansion an exceptional opportunity for a Senior Data Engineer.
Leading the strategic direction of the Software Engineering Team you will have 10+ Years experience with exceptional Python, SQL and AWS component experience.
Senior Data Engineer
Location: Fully Remote (London Based Company)
Salary: to £95,000 + Benefits
Key Skills:
• Experience designing and building high throughput, scalable, resilient and secure data pipelines. • Experience with the following AWS technologies: Glue jobs, Athena, S3, Step functions, Lambda, RDS (Aurora Postgres), DMS, Redshift, QuickSight, Kenesis Firehose.
• Expert knowledge of SQL.
• Hands on experience with Kafka.
• Hands on experience with Terraform.
• Hands on experience of Python with a Data Analytics programming paradigm.
• Experience building CI/CD pipelines
• Exceptional troubleshooting and debugging skills.
Good to have:
• Experience with design and implementation of integration solutions for event/data streaming.
• Experience working with Apache Superset.
• Start-up experience.
• Exposure to Payments domain – ideally sanctions screening.
Key Responsibilities:
• Lead the design, development and enhancement of our data pipelines to support use cases such as reporting, data extraction/export etc.
• Own the delivery of your code from design all the way to production.
• Collaborate with Software Engineers to develop the platform.
• Collaborate with the Product team to provide expert Data Engineering advice and recommendations.
• Collaborate across the wider Technology teams (Architecture, Security) to ensure code adheres to the architecture designs and security standards (i.e. vulnerabilities).
• Ensure code always meets the required engineering standards.
• Support the Engineering Lead driving the strategic direction of the Software Engineering department.
• Support and mentor Data Engineering colleagues.